Hello? I'm still working on conversion from DAQ to DAQmx.
We have a SCAN_Start function needed to be converted.
Old code is
//err = SCAN_Start( 1, dbuffer, sampleCount, 0, sampleTicks, 0, GroupTicks );
New code is
int32 read=500; //sampleTicks*10;
float64 data[8000];
DAQmxErrChk(DAQmxCreateTask("", &SCAN_Handle));
DAQmxErrChk(DAQmxCreateAIVoltageChan(SCAN_Handle,"Dev1/ai0:3","",DAQmx_Val_Diff,-10.0,10.0,DAQmx_Val_Volts,NULL));
DAQmxErrChk(DAQmxGetAIGain(SCAN_Handle, "Dev1/ai0:3" /*(const char*)channel*/ , (double*)gain)); //SCAN_Setup
DAQmxErrChk(DAQmxSetAIConvTimebaseDiv(SCAN_Handle, 500)); //sampleTicks*10
DAQmxErrChk(DAQmxSetSampClkTimebaseDiv(SCAN_Handle, 2000)); //GroupTicks*10
DAQmxErrChk(DAQmxCfgDigEdgeStartTrig(SCAN_Handle, "/Dev1/PFI0", DAQmx_Val_Rising ));
DAQmxErrChk(DAQmxCfgSampClkTiming(SCAN_Handle,"",samplePerChanPerSec,DAQmx_Val_Rising,DAQmx_Val_FiniteSamps,sampleCounts)); // Analog channel timing, trigger
DAQmxErrChk(DAQmxReadAnalogF64(SCAN_Handle,800,10.0,DAQmx_Val_GroupByChannel,data,sampleCounts,&read,NULL));
DAQmxErrChk(DAQmxStartTask(SCAN_Handle));
But new code returns countless errors saying "The specific resource is reserved. The operation could not be completed as specified. The status code: -50103."
1. Is this happening due to the sane handler name on different functions?
2. And the conversion is right?
3. I assume that dbuffer of DAQ is data of DAQmx. Is this right?
4. How old DAQ code SCAN_Start returns dbuffer value?
